I have 4 henry rifles sofar. golden boy 17HMR, H001T .22LR, pump, .22LR, H010 45-70. and just ordered a long ranger .223 today. Henry makes a good porduct and are very good to deal with. If you call them a real person answers the phone. that make me want to get more.

the pump is a lot of fun to shoot. it was a little stiff to work the action, but took apart and lubed and polished a few parts and now can work it with my thumb and fore finger no problem. just recieved skinner peep site for it. will shoot it when the weather warms up. get the .22lr one because you will put a lot of ammo through it.roddy wrote:Welcome. How do you like the little pump? I have been eyeing one in .22 Magnum.
